Everything you need to know about gravel delivery in Will County.
Choose materials based on function, drainage, and appearance rather than a single “best” option. For load-bearing areas pick materials that compact well; for drainage choose coarser, free-draining aggregates; for garden beds or decorative areas choose materials that match the look you want. Regional sourcing means texture and color can vary, so use photos as a guide and contact our team if you need help selecting the right option.
Will County’s freeze-thaw cycles and seasonal rainfall make drainage and frost resistance important considerations. Materials that drain well and resist frost heave are better for driveways and paths, while finer materials may be fine for filling or grading where drainage is managed. If you have concerns about winter conditions, mention them when ordering so we can suggest suitable options.
Measure the area in square feet and decide the desired depth in inches, then convert to cubic yards; most online calculators will convert that volume to tons based on material density. Round up to allow for compaction and uneven grading, and remember our minimum order is 3 tons. Use our material calculator or contact our team with dimensions and we can help confirm quantities.

Some drivers may be able to perform tailgate spreading, but this is done at their discretion and depends on site conditions and safety. Request spreading at checkout and the driver will assess whether it can be done safely upon arrival. No spreading guarantees are provided, so plan for manual or machine spreading if you need a precise finish.
Clear the drop area of vehicles, trash, and landscaping items and provide a stable access route for a heavy dump truck. Mark the preferred drop location with flags or stakes and note any overhead wires, narrow gates, or low branches in Order Notes. If you expect tight access or need special placement, tell our team ahead of time so we can coordinate with the driver.
Local rules vary across Will County municipalities and homeowners associations, so check with your city, township, or HOA before ordering. Common requirements include driveway permits, curb-cut approvals, and restrictions on blocking public streets during delivery. If you’re unsure, contact your local municipal office and let us know any permit requirements when you place your order.

Spring and summer are peak seasons for landscaping and construction projects, so order early to secure materials and preferred delivery dates. Fall is good for grading and erosion-control work, while winter deliveries may be limited by frozen ground, snow, or road restrictions. If you need fast turnaround, consider the next-day option for orders placed before noon CST, but expect additional fees during busy periods.
Key concerns in this region are drainage, compaction, and frost-related movement. Choose materials suited to the function: free-draining aggregates for drainage, well-graded materials for compaction, and erosion-control mixes on slopes. If your project has heavy loads or standing water, mention those conditions so we can recommend appropriate materials and installation practices.
